Let's start with the basics. What exactly is the spark plug gap? Well, the spark plug gap is the distance between the center electrode and the ground electrode at the tip of the spark plug. This gap is measured in thousandths of an inch or millimeters, and it's a critical specification that can vary depending on the make and model of your generator.

The spark plug gap plays a vital role in the combustion process within your generator's engine. When the ignition system sends an electrical current to the spark plug, a spark is created across the gap. This spark ignites the air - fuel mixture in the combustion chamber, which in turn powers the engine. If the gap is too small or too large, it can cause a whole bunch of problems.

If the spark plug gap is too small, the spark may not be strong enough to ignite the air - fuel mixture effectively. This can lead to incomplete combustion, which means your generator won't run as efficiently. You might notice symptoms like rough idling, misfiring, and a decrease in power output. In some cases, a small gap can even cause the engine to stall, leaving you in the lurch when you need your generator the most.

On the other hand, if the gap is too large, the ignition system has to work harder to create a spark across the wider distance. This can put additional strain on the ignition coil and other components, potentially leading to premature failure. A large gap can also cause the spark to be inconsistent or weak, resulting in poor combustion and reduced engine performance.

So, how do you determine the correct spark plug gap for your generator? The best way is to refer to the generator's owner's manual. The manual will typically specify the recommended gap for your particular model. If you don't have the manual, you can also check the manufacturer's website or contact their customer support for the information.

Checking and adjusting the spark plug gap is a relatively simple process, but it does require a bit of care. You'll need a spark plug gap tool, which you can find at most auto parts stores. First, remove the spark plug from the generator using a spark plug socket. Then, use the gap tool to measure the distance between the electrodes. If the gap is off, you can carefully bend the ground electrode to adjust it. But be careful not to bend it too much, as this can damage the electrode.

It's important to note that over time, the spark plug gap can change due to normal wear and tear. The constant exposure to high - temperature combustion gases can cause the electrodes to erode, which can increase the gap. That's why it's a good idea to check the spark plug gap regularly as part of your generator maintenance routine.

In addition to the gap, there are other factors to consider when choosing a spark plug for your generator. The heat range of the spark plug, for example, can affect its performance. A spark plug with the wrong heat range can cause problems like fouling or pre - ignition. The heat range refers to the ability of the spark plug to dissipate heat from the tip. A colder plug is better for high - performance engines, while a hotter plug is more suitable for engines that operate at lower speeds.
